Limp Bizkit to release two LPs this year

The 'Rollin'' star has been updating fans via Twitter on the progress of the band's next album.
After he wrote that the seventeenth song had been mixed for upcoming album Gold Cobra, he revealed: "Obviously we have two albums here, in case you didn't pick up on that. First one is Gold Cobra. Due soon."
There are no confirmed release dates for either album yet, although the American rocker did tweet a fan stating that Gold Cobra "will be out way before the end of summer."
It was also confirmed that Lil Wayne will feature on a Limp Bizkit track.
Durst wrote: "Oh, excuse me, 16th song mixed is 'Ready To Go' featuring Lil Wayne! I love it."
